@Ruhrpottpatriot No, that's not correct. "Hung" is the past tense to use if you are hanging up clothes on a line or pictures on a wall. "Hanged" is the past tense to use if it is about people hanging themselves, i.e. killing themselves, or killing other people by hanging. From the context in...
